Well, why don't I look at it this way:
1(5): Glenn Dorsey - Already trade rumors swirling. Still with us.
1(15): Branden Albert - Absolute stud. Still with us.
2(35): Brandon Flowers - Straight baller. Still with us.
3(73): Jamaal Charles - Did alright. Still with us.
3(76): Brad Cottam - Hopefully makes strides this year. Still with us.
3(82): Dajuan Morgan - Unsure where he'll fit. Still with us.
4(105): Will Franklin - Cut. On the Lions now.
5(140): Brandon Carr - Unsure where he will fit. Still with us.
6(170): Barry Richardson - Looked decent. Still with us.
6(182): Kevin Robinson - Cut. Free agent.
7(210): Brian Johnston - Called, by Scott, the steal of the 2008 draft. Cut. Free agent.
7(239): Mike Merritt - Cut. Free agent.
Since last year, we've cut 4 players, Dorsey has been linked with trade talks, and Carr might not have a starting spot this year. No idea where Morgan will fit anymore as well.
Cut 4 players, talking about trading our first pick and drafting positions we didn't necessarily need (CB comes to mind, especially who we picked).
